Insight 2: Understanding the Unique Challenges of Voice-Activated Local Search Optimization

While traditional search engine optimization (SEO) techniques are still relevant, voice-activated local search optimization presents some unique challenges that businesses in Boca Raton must address. One of the key differences is the shift from short, keyword-based search queries to longer, conversational phrases.

When people use voice search, they tend to ask questions in a more natural and conversational manner. For example, instead of typing “best Italian restaurant Boca Raton,” a user might ask their virtual assistant, “Where can I find the best Italian restaurant in Boca Raton?” This change in search behavior requires businesses to optimize their online content to match these longer, more conversational queries.

Another challenge is the need to provide concise and accurate information in response to voice queries. Virtual assistants often read out the top search results to users, so businesses need to ensure their website content is structured in a way that provides the most relevant information upfront. This can include optimizing meta tags, featured snippets, and business listings to increase the chances of being selected as the preferred answer by virtual assistants.

Section 5: Structured Data Markup for Voice Search

Structured data markup plays a vital role in voice-activated local search optimization. By implementing schema markup on your website, you provide search engines with additional context about your business, making it easier for them to understand and display relevant information in voice search results. For example, adding markup for your business’s name, address, phone number, and customer reviews can greatly enhance your visibility in voice search results.

2. Structured Data Markup

Structured data markup is another important aspect of voice-activated local search optimization. It involves adding specific code snippets to a website’s HTML to provide search engines with additional context about the content. This structured data helps search engines understand the information on a webpage more accurately, which can improve visibility in voice search results.

For Boca Raton businesses, implementing structured data markup can enhance their chances of appearing in voice search results for local queries. By including relevant structured data such as business name, address, phone number, operating hours, and customer reviews, businesses can provide search engines with the necessary information to display in voice search results.

5. How can I optimize my business’s online listings for voice search?

To optimize your business’s online listings for voice search, you should make sure that your business name, address, and phone number (NAP) are consistent across all platforms. You can also add relevant keywords and phrases to your business descriptions and include photos and videos that showcase your products or services.

6. Are there any voice search-specific directories or platforms I should focus on?

While there are no voice search-specific directories or platforms, it’s important to ensure that your business is listed on popular platforms like Google My Business, Yelp, and Bing Places. These platforms are commonly used by virtual assistants and smart speakers to provide voice search results.
